PASTA IN ALMOND GARLIC SAUCE

Steps:

  • Purée blanched almonds and garlic with water and 1/4 teaspoon salt in a blender until smooth.
  • Cook cavatappi in a pasta pot of boiling salted water (3 tablespoons salt for 6 quarts water) until almost al dente. Reserve 3 cups pasta-cooking water and drain pasta.
  • Meanwhile, heat oil and 1 tablespoon butter in a 12-inch heavy skillet (preferably straight-sided) over medium heat until foam subsides. Add almond purée and simmer, whisking occasionally, until thickened, about 3 minutes. Add 2 1/2 cups reserved cooking water, 1/4 teaspoon salt, and 1/2 teaspoon pepper and simmer, whisking occasionally, until slightly thickened, 3 to 4 minutes. Whisk in remaining 2 tablespoons butter until melted. Add pasta and peas and cook, stirring occasionally, until pasta is al dente (sauce will be thin), 2 to 3 minutes. Add cheese and lemon juice and stir until combined well. Remove from heat and stir in half of basil and mint and salt and pepper to taste. Serve pasta in bowls topped with chopped almonds, remaining herbs, and additional cheese.

3/4 cup whole blanched almonds (4 ounces)
3 garlic cloves, smashed
3/4 cup water
1 pound cavatappi or other small tubular pasta
2 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
3 tablespoon unsalted butter, divided
1 (10-ounces) package frozen peas
1/2 cup grated Parmigiano-Reggiano plus additional for serving
1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ice
1/2 cup basil leaves (torn if large), divided
1/3 cup mint leaves (torn if large), divided
1/3 cup chopped roasted almonds (2 ounces)

VEGAN ROASTED-GARLIC MASHED POTATOES

Yellow-fleshed potatoes, like Yukon gold, are dense, creamy and moderately starchy, making them perfect for mashed potatoes-especially these vegan spuds, which have no dairy and are low in calories and fat.

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F. Place the garlic on a piece of foil, drizzle with 1 teaspoon of the oil, wrap and roast until very tender, about 20 minutes.
  • Meanwhile, put the potatoes in a large saucepan, cover by 1 inch with cold water and bring to a boil. Reduce the heat to a simmer and cook until the potatoes are very tender, about 20 minutes. Strain and return the potatoes to the saucepan.
  • Add the roasted garlic with any juice that has collected, almond milk, remaining 2 teaspoons of oil and 1 1/4 teaspoons salt to the potatoes. Mash with a potato masher until smooth or to the desired consistency, adding additional almond milk if necessary. Stir in the chives and add salt to taste. Transfer the potatoes to a serving bowl, garnish with additional chives and serve.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 200 calorie, Fat 4 grams, SaturatedFat 0.5 grams, Sodium 670 milligrams, Carbohydrate 39 grams, Fiber 4 grams, Protein 5 grams, Sugar 4 grams

4 large cloves garlic, peeled
3 teaspoons extra-virgin olive oil
2 pounds Yukon gold potatoes, unpeeled, cut into 3/4-inch cubes (about 4 potatoes)
1 cup plain unsweetened almond or other plant-based milk, warm, plus more if needed
Kosher salt
2 tablespoons minced chives (about 1/4 a small bunch), plus more for garnish

POTATO-GARLIC SAUCE WITH ALMONDS

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 400 degrees. Place a large sheet of aluminum foil on the counter. Put the garlic cloves on the foil and drizzle with 2 teaspoons of oil. Toss to coat. Wrap the foil around the garlic and bake until the garlic is very soft, about 45 minutes. When cool enough to handle, squeeze out the garlic into a small bowl and set aside.
  • Place the potatoes in a medium-size pot and just cover with cold, salted water. Bring to a boil over high heat, then lower and simmer until very tender, about 17 minutes.
  • Drain the potatoes, transfer to a large bowl and set aside to cool.
  • Mash together the potatoes, garlic and almonds with a fork. Beat in the vinegar, parsley and the remaining 3/4cup oil until well mixed. Season with salt and pepper. Spread on bread or serve as a complement to roasted meats or fried fish.

20 cloves garlic, unpeeled
3/4 cup, plus 2 teaspoons, extra-virgin olive oil
4 Idaho potatoes (about 1 1/2 pounds), peeled and quartered
5 tablespoons slivered, toasted almonds (about 1 ounce)
6 tablespoons red-wine vinegar
2 tablespoons finely chopped parsley
Kosher salt and freshly ground pepper to taste

SMOKY SWEET POTATOES WITH EGGS AND ALMONDS

Slow-roasting sweet potatoes in coconut oil and spices gives them a rich flavor and delicately crisp texture on their exterior while they turn velvety within. Don't be tempted to take them out of the oven early. As Steven D., a reader, wrote in the notes of the recipe upon which this one is based: "The potatoes are soft after a half hour or so, but then the crusts harden in the second half hour, giving them the delicious texture that makes the dish unique." Adding fried eggs, a smoky yogurt sauce and crunchy almonds turns a sweet potato side dish into a satisfying, meatless meal. And if you don't have coconut oil on hand, you can use olive or another cooking oil, though the potatoes won't have the same texture.

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 350 degrees. Melt 2 tablespoons coconut oil in a small saucepan over low heat or in the microwave. In a large bowl, toss together sweet potatoes, melted coconut oil, salt, spice mix, smoked paprika, cumin, black pepper and thyme.
  • Spread the potatoes in an even layer on a large rimmed baking sheet.
  • Roast, stirring and flipping the potatoes occasionally, until soft and caramelized, about 1 hour.
  • As the potatoes roast, place yogurt in a small bowl. Stir in garlic, a large pinch or two of smoked paprika, and salt and black pepper to taste.
  • In a large skillet, add remaining 1 tablespoon of coconut oil over medium-high heat and let it heat up for 20 to 30 seconds. Crack eggs into skillet and season with salt. Cook until the whites have set with crispy edges and the yolks are still runny, about 2 to 3 minutes (or cook the eggs for a few minutes longer for a medium or firm yolk, if you prefer).
  • To serve, spoon sweet potatoes onto individual plates and top with yogurt sauce and almonds. Place eggs on top, and sprinkle with paprika and herbs. Serve immediately.

3 tablespoons coconut oil
2 pounds sweet potatoes, peeled or unpeeled, and cut into 1/2-inch chunks
3/4 teaspoon fine sea or table salt, plus more as needed
3/4 teaspoon garam masala, Baharat, curry powder or another spice mix
1/2 teaspoon smoked paprika, plus more as needed
1/4 teaspoon ground cumin
1/4 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per, plus more as needed
3 to 5 thyme sprigs
1/2 cup plain Greek yogurt
1 small garlic clove, finely grated, passed through a press or minced
Eggs, for frying, as many as you like
1/2 cup chopped Marcona or salted, roasted almonds
Soft herbs, such as parsley, mint or cilantro, for serving

SKORDALIA RECIPE: GREEK GARLIC AND POTATO DIP

  • Peel and dice the potatoes and rinse under cool water. Add them to a saucepan and top with water (water should cover the potatoes by about 2 inches). Add a good pinch of kosher salt to the water. Bring to a boil, then lower heat to medium-low and let simmer until potatoes are tender (about 15 minutes). They should easily break at this point. Rinse them again, this time under hot water. And set aside for 5 to 7 minutes (you want the moisture to evaporate)
  • In a food processor, combine blanched almonds (shelled walnuts will work too) with garlic and lemon juice. Add a good pinch of kosher salt. Run the processor until the mixture turns into a paste. (It might be a bit grainy, keep going until you achieve the smoothest paste you can. It will still have some texture, which is fine).
  • Here's where the magic happens! Add about half of the extra virgin olive oil, but do it one bit at a time while using a wooden spoon to mix the potatoes. Add the garlic and almond paste and keep adding the extra virgin olive oil a little bit at a time while using a wooden spoon to mix everything together. (You want to reach a fluffy potato dip). Taste and add kosher salt to your liking. Mix again to combine. (Note: at this point, you can chill the skordalia to serve at a later time).
